<strong>AG</strong> <strong>Mini</strong> <strong>Mini</strong>-A-<strong>CAES</strong>/2 <strong>CAES</strong>/2 <strong>TES</strong> Cost Estimates<br />

One pressure level<br />

Min/max pressure 13/22 bar<br />

Roundtrip efficiency 63%<br />

Easier control strategy<br />

Lower cost<br />

Cost estimates (10 MW):<br />

• 940 €/kWh<br />

• 2000 €/kW<br />

Two pressure levels<br />

Min/max pressure 34/56 bar<br />

Roundtrip efficiency 64%<br />

Slightly more complex control<br />

Higher cost<br />

Cost Cost estimates estimates (10MW): (10MW):<br />

• 980 €/kWh<br />

• 2330 €/kW<br />

Investment cost breakdown (CAPEX)<br />

Component 1 pressure level (€/kW) 2 pressure levels (€/kW)<br />

Heat exchangers 238 12% 572 25%<br />

Turbomachinery 398 20% 323 14%<br />

<strong>TES</strong> 29 1% 63 3%<br />

<strong>Compressed</strong> air tanks 1152 58% 1099 47%<br />

Contingency/civil works 182 9% 276 12%<br />

Total 1999 2333
